Otkako sam instalirao nove drajvere za Intel 536EP modem (verzija 4.69) konekcija se stalno prekida, otprilike svako 3-4 minute.Slijedio sam instrukcije u README fajlu, ali se pri instalaciji pojavio problem (depmod: ***Unresolved symbols in /lib/modules/2.4.21-99-default/kernel/drivers/char/Intel536.o).To sam rijesio tako sto sam fajl Intel536.o obrisao i ponovo pokrenuo instalaciju nakon cega sam uspjesno instalirao.
A vjerovatno treba dodati i ovo ispod:
fscking softverski modemi (pa ovo baš i ne, lol)
Hajde pokreni ovu komandu (kao root)
# grep echo-request /var/log/*
Ako dobiješ output u stilu:
pppd[xxx] No response to N echo requests
problem je u pppd postavkama (’/etc/ppp/options’ datoteka).
Kucaj
# egrep -v '#|^ *$' /etc/ppp/options
da vidiš postavke, a problematične su lcp-echo-interval i lcp-echo-failure. Povisi interval ili broj pokušaja, pa vidi da li se dešava ista stvar. Defaultne postavke od 30 sec i 4 pokušaja dovoljne su za većinu normalnih modema, ali se SuSE i Intel536 nikako ne vole (šta li oni rade sa tim kernelima).
“Unresolved symbol” je uvijek znak da nešto fali. Kad pokreneš neki modul, program depmod pogleda u datoteku modules.dep koji moduli ovise jedni od drugih. Ako vidi da nekom modulu treba modul intel536 a da taj modul nepostoji ispod /lib/modules/verzija kernela/… onda javi ovu grešku. Znači moraš prekontrolisati da je modul instaliran na pravo mjesto, a to je /lib/modules/verz.kernela-koju koristiš/modem ili sl… To se većinom upiše u makefileu prije instalacije. Možda je to to.